Summary
A vulnerability has been found in Apple iOS and iPadOS up to 13.1.3 and classified as critical. Affected is an unknown function of the component Kernel. The manipulation leads to memory corruption. This vulnerability is traded as CVE-2019-8786. An attack has to be approached locally. There is no exploit available. The affected component should be upgraded.
Details
A vulnerability was found in Apple iOS and iPadOS up to 13.1.3 (Smartphone Operating System). It has been rated as critical. This issue affects an unknown part of the component Kernel. The manipulation with an unknown input leads to a memory corruption vulnerability. Using CWE to declare the problem leads to C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
A memory corruption issue was addressed with improved memory handling. This issue is fixed in iOS 13.2 and iPadOS 13.2, macOS Catalina 10.15.1, tvOS 13.2, watchOS 6.1. An application may be able to execute arbitrary code with kernel privileges.
The weakness was shared 10/28/2019 as HT210721 as confirmed advisory (Website). It is possible to read the advisory at support.apple.com. The identification of this vulnerability is CVE-2019-8786. Attacking locally is a requirement. A simple authentication is necessary for exploitation. The technical details are unknown and an exploit is not publicly available. The pricing for an exploit might be around USD $5k-$25k at the moment (estimation calculated on 01/31/2024). It is expected to see the exploit prices for this product increasing in the near future. The advisory points out:
A memory corruption issue was addressed with improved memory handling.
Upgrading to version 13.2 eliminates this vulnerability. A possible mitigation has been published immediately after the disclosure of the vulnerability.
